E-Mail Immune cells specialize to ensure the most efficient defense against viruses and other pathogens. Researchers at the University of Basel have shed light on this specialization of T cells and shown that it occurs differently in the context of an acute and a chronic infection. This could be relevant for new approaches against chronic viral infections. Researchers led by Professor Carolyn King of the University of Basel have developed a method to study the specialization of T cells in the context of infections. In the journal eLife, they report the different directions this specialization takes, depending on whether it happens in the context of an acute viral infection such as influenza or a chronic one such as HIV infection or malaria, which can no longer be overcome by the body. ....
E-Mail A research team at the University of Basel has discovered immune cells resident in the lungs that persist long after a bout of flu. Experiments with mice have shown that these helper cells improve the immune response to reinfection by a different strain of the flu virus. The discovery could yield approaches to developing longer-lasting vaccinations against quickly-mutating viruses. At the start of the coronavirus pandemic, some already began to raise the question of how long immunity lasts after weathering SARS-CoV-2. The same question has now arisen regarding the COVID-19 vaccination. A key role is played by immunological memory - a complex interplay of immune cells, antibodies and signaling substances that allows the body to fight off known pathogens very efficiently. ....
